Skip to content
本页目录

Locas 低代码研发平台

Locas低代码研发平台是在MAS模块化应用支撑平台之上,以微应用模式开发扩展的低代码应用开发、运行的支撑平台。它提供低代码项目管理、模板管理、项目空间等功能,实现低代码在线研发。通过图形化拖拽等实现快速前端组件与页面、后端服务、菜单定义、权限定义、图标图片资源管理及应用发布等。

功能范围

  • 项目管理与项目空间
  • 页面设计器
  • 服务设计器
  • 微应用应用发布
  • 项目备份与还原
  • 页面模板库
  • 项目模板库

版本

v2.2,发布于2023年8月7日

  • 支持低代码开发工作门户的业务卡片

更新内容

版本更新内容如下:

新增

  • 发布增加mobilePage模式;
  • 发布增加业务卡片逻辑;
  • 增加在groovy服务脚本中新增定时任务;
  • 资源oss存储支持一个oss存储桶内内自定义根目录(服务中通过环境变量PLAT_OSS_ROOT_DIR来自定义应用/资源的存储根位置,对应nginx的njs/oss-sign.js中的ossAccess.rootDir值应与后台服务环境变量PLAT_OSS_ROOT_DIR值一致)。

修改

  • 修复bug,还原时删除t_service_process_definition原记录,避免数据重复;
  • 修复bug,项目备份时遗漏了服务编排的xml;
  • 修复bug,还原或导入服务时,对processDefinition 进行非空判断,避免空指针;
  • 去掉知识库sql服务中字段加别名的语句,解决达梦数据version关键字问题。

优化

  • 发布依赖mas-block 调整为locar,废弃引用逻辑调整;
  • 重构资源服务代码,优化oss存储逻辑;
  • 重构知识库项目空间查询项目列表服务,解决兼容省厅生产环境sql执行不符合预期。

补丁

基于MAS平台版本

Locas 基于 MAS v5.8

微服务版本明细

序号微应用Code版本号说明
1低代码引擎locas-service2.2.6
2数据引擎dataengin1.0.0-SNAPSHOT
3项目管理(任务日志等)projectspace1.0.0-SNAPSHOT

如何获取微服务镜像?

所有镜像可到容器仓库通过 docker pull 拉取

  • 武汉公司内网:192.168.1.10:5000/tangram/[微服务名]:[版本号]
  • 阿里云:registry.cn-hangzhou.aliyuncs.com/tangram/[微服务名]:[版本号]

如何获取微服务jar包?

所有正式发布版本可到私服仓库下载

  • 下载地址:http://nps.zktx-soft.com:19098/repository/maven-public/com/gsoft/[平台:mas|locas]/[应用名]/[版本号]/[应用名]-[版本号].jar

例:http://nps.zktx-soft.com:19098/repository/maven-public/com/gsoft/mas/mas-admin/5.8.3/mas-admin-5.8.3.jar

微应用版本明细

序号微应用Code版本号更新说明
1Locar渲染引擎locar2.2.4原maui-block
2Locas低代码设计器locas2.2.4原maui-pages,对应locas-service
4PC基础组件lc-system-tools以平台导出为准
5低代码项目管理lc-project-workspace以平台导出为准

如何获取应用tgz安装包?

所有安装包可到阿里云OSS仓库下载

  • 路径:oss://foa5-oss/deploy/[平台:mas/locas]/[应用名称]/[版本号]/[应用名称]-[版本号].tgz 如:oss://foa5-oss/deploy/locas/locas/2.2.4/locas-2.2.4.tgz

初始化安装

  • locas平台数据库初始化脚本 下载

升级安装

  • 基于5.7升级到5.8版本升级资料,存放于OSS(路径 oss://foa5-oss/deploy-119-docs/5.8.0/)

内部资料,请勿外传